Adding fields to a data type

Updated on September 10, 2021

Define fields to structure the data that defines a single object. You can add fields to data types and specify the field type, such as Picklist, Boolean, or Text (single line). For example, to include a field that displays the confirmation number for an online order, you might add a Confirmation number field to the Purchase order data type, and then select Text (single line) as the field type.

  1. In the App Studio navigation panel, click Data.
  2. Under Data, click Data types and integrations.
  3. Click a data type name.
  4. Add fields by repeating the following actions for each field:
    1. On the Data model tab, click + Add field.
    2. Enter the name of the field.
    3. In the Type column, select the data type that you want to store.
  5. Click Save.
